Detailed explanation-1: -Value neutrality, as described by Max Weber, is the duty of sociologists to identify and acknowledge their own values and overcome their personal biases when conducting sociological research.

Detailed explanation-2: -Max Weber (1919) Researchers’ personal values must influence their choice of the topic of research. However, the values of the researchers must not affect the research methodology. Sociologists must define the exact stages of the research practice where bias could come into play.

Detailed explanation-3: -Value freedom Some sociologists argue that staying value free is impossible because sociologists are humans studying other humans. Some even go so far as to say that it is desirable to use their values to improve society.

Detailed explanation-4: -In the late 19th and early 20th centuries Positivist Sociologists such as August Comte and Emile Durkheim regarded Sociology as a science and thus thought that social research could and should be value free, or scientific.
